#714546 Hex color

#714546

The hexadecimal color code #714546 corresponds to the code RGB( 113, 69, 70 ). It's a shade of Red. This color is a combination of red (at 0,44 level), green (at 0,27 level) and blue (at 0,27 level). Its brightness is 35% and its saturation is 24%. It is composed of red at 44%, green at 27% and blue at 27%.
